IT Manager – Service Desk & Operations
St. Louis, MO or Kansas City, MO
Overview:
Optomi, in partnership with a leading organization, is seeking a hands-on IT Manager to lead Service Desk operations while driving continuous improvement across IT support processes, incident management, and service delivery. This role is ideal for a technical leader who enjoys balancing people management with day-to-day operational involvement, helping modernize support processes, improve documentation, automate manual tasks, and elevate the overall end-user experience.
The IT Manager will oversee a distributed Service Desk supporting more than 1,000 users across multiple offices and remote locations. Working closely with IT Operations leadership, this individual will lead major incident response efforts, develop ITIL-aligned processes, analyze service metrics, and identify opportunities to improve efficiency and scalability. The ideal candidate is a collaborative leader who is comfortable rolling up their sleeves, mentoring team members, and implementing practical solutions that improve service delivery.
